On Monday, Emmanuel Macron reiterated that France was ready to "help" Algeria in the face of forest fires. Fires in the north-east of the country caused the death of at least 12 people and caused dozens of injuries. Algerian President Abdelmadjid Tebboune decreed a three-day national mourning. - Killing fires in Algeria: France is ready to "help", says Emmanuel Macron (International).
In the continuation of the warming of relations between France and Algeria, Emmanuel Macron offered his Algerian counterpart Abdelmadjid Tebboune support after the violent forest fires that killed at least 12 people near Béjaia, Jijel and Tizi-Ouzou.
